JENNIFER AZZI ERA: Thisseasonmarksthesecondseasonaswomen’sbasketballlegendJenniferAzziasheadcoach.Azzi,whowasnamedtothehelmoftheprograminAprilof2010,bringsanunprecedentedwealthofbasketballexperiencetotheprogram.The2009Women’sBasketballHallofFameinducteeplayedfiveseasonsintheWNBA,wasafoundingmemberoftheAmericanBasketballLeague(ABL),playedoverseasandenjoyedanAll-AmericancollegiatecareeratStanford.Internation-ally,AzziwasamemberoftheUSABasketballSeniorNationalTeamfrom1990-91and1993-98.AkeymemberoftheUnitedStatesgoldmedal-winning1996OlympicTeamthatconcludedaperfect60-0seasonwithan8-0recordduringtheOlympicGamesinAtlanta,Azziplayedon13USANationalTeams,compilingamarkof114-14.ShealsomedaledthreetimesattheWorldChampionships,claiminggoldin1998and1990,whileearningabronzein1994.

Steding, an Olympic gold medalist and a NCAA National Champion at Stanford University, joined the Dons in 2010 from Columbia University. Prior to coaching the Lions, Steding spent a season as an assistant coach for the Atlanta Dream of the WNBA and seven years at Warner Pacific.
